Asalaam-a-laikum, respected Brothers

Please answer the following question.

If a woman has been divorced by her husband before the marriage was consummated and she has observed Iddat because the couple had spent time alone together, can they remarry?

Under what circumstances the couple can remarry if the husband divorced his wife.

Jazahk-Allah-Khair

Answer

Ulamaa
Ulamaa ID 04

Answer last updated on:
25th July 2009
Answered by: Ulamaa ID 04

Website
Location: London

Bismillah

Al-jawab billahi at-taufeeq (the answer with Allah's guidance)



1) Yes, they can remarry.

2) If the husband divorced his wife three times, the wife cannot remarry until a Shar'ee Halalah has taken place.

Halalah: http://www.muftisays.com/qa.php?viewpage=viewQA&question=2668


If there was only one or two divorces then the wife may remarry after the Iddat period expires.



And Only Allah Ta'ala Knows Best.
